Kt3ultra2 and geforce cards (my experience)

Well... I thought that I should share this with the rest of you.  Especially those having problems making the kt3ultra2 happy with geforce cards.  I RMA'd one board, but the new one I got did the same thing.  The problem was the 'random reboot' in 3d games.  I addressed all issues from heat to power etc.. timing, driving value, driver versions (4in1 and nvidia)... bla blah.   Here are my findings:
I could never get a geforce2 ti or mx to work with this board without crashing in bf1942 and in medal of honor.  I tried two vendors for the geforce2 cards.  Perhaps others will have better luck (I know some have) but I blame incompatibilities on the card maker (not the GPU maker).  Mine was an AOpen gf2ti, a friends, a visiontek gf2mx.
A friends geforce4 440mx worked great (chaintech) and so did the geforce4 4200 ti (gainward brand, red board just like kt3ultra2!) that I ended up buying.  With both of the geforce4 cards, I used a dram voltage (system ram) of 2.6.  I also enabled fast write on my agp bus.  I have read elsewhere that dram voltage can go down under load and that bumping it up to 2.6 will privide more tollerance to dropping below the 2.5 requirement (or something to that nature).  I found that it DID make the system stable with this gf4 and my two pc2700 dimms.
As of now, my system is stable (finally).  One thing I can say for the kt3ultra2 is that it really is agp picky.  I don't know if this is common to all kt333 chipsets or not but I can safely say that gf2's just *don't work* with this board in my experience.  There are many cases of people with it working though so like I said earlier.. it's probably the array of card makers that are causing this.

    Hi Trisha,
    The only modern Mac's with video cards are the Mac Pro and Xserve (server) systems. They both are priced quite a bit higher than any Mac Mini.
    Some systems, like the Mac Book Pro laptop can be ordered with different graphics cards, but that has be done when the system is built, as it is not replaceable once the system is built. To find out which systems, go to store.apple.com. For each system that you select, you can see if there's an option for a better video card.

    Here's how GPU performance can slow down on an LGA 1155 platform: The CPU itself has only 16 available PCI-e lanes. Normally, all 16 of those lanes are fed to the GPU that's sitting in the primary PCI-e x16 slot. But on most LGA 1155 motherboards, if you add a second GPU, then the bandwidth of the primary PCI-e x16 slot will drop to only x8 bandwidth because the secondary PCI-e x16 slot would then steal eight of those PCI-e lanes from the primary x16 slot. (There are a few LGA 1155 motherboards that maintain x16 bandwidth in the primary x16 slot even with a second GPU installed - but that is because the "secondary" x16-length slot is actually only an x4 slot, run off of the P67/Z68/Z77 PCH in PCI-e 2.0 x4 mode, instead of directly off of the CPU.) (By the way, LGA 1155 CPUs have 20 total PCI-e lanes - but four of those are actually fed to the P67/Z68/Z77 PCH, making only 16 lanes available for GPUs.)
    And we've been advising against the Quadro 5000 because it is now two generations old, and as such outdated. In fact, it dates all the way back to 2010 when the first-generation hexacore i7, the i7-980X, was brand new (Sandy Bridge was not yet on the market back then). As a GPU, it is no faster than an old GeForce GTX 465 that it's based on because although both GPUs have 352 CUDA cores, the Quadro 5000's low actual clock speed of 513MHz (compared to the 607 MHz of the GTX 465) completely offsets the Quadro 5000's higher memory bandwidth of 120 GB/s (versus 102.6 GB/s on the GTX 465). Yet it still costs more than $1,500 new, even today. That's extremely severely overpriced for a GPU that's only going to be used in a secondary capacity, with the GPU going almost completely unutilized most of the time.
    Finally, there is the issue of driver compatibility: GeForce drivers generally do not work with Quadros, nor do Quadro drivers work with GeForces. And there is a good chance that the two drivers will conflict with one another, seriously affecting stability and performance. That is more likely to occur if the GeForce and Quadro cards are of two completely different GPU generations (for example, that Quadro 5000 that you're considering may clash with the GeForce 600-series GPU that's being used as primary). So, to minimize the risk of such conflicts, only consider a K-series Quadro if you need 10-bit output for a system that normally uses a GeForce GTX 600-series GPU. (This means that as a secondary output GPU for 10-bit monitors, a $400 Quadro K2000 or even a $200 Quadro K600 would suffice as a secondary output card.)
